Overview

T

Tulip

Tulip helps you digitize your shop floor operations without needing a background in coding. You can build custom logic-based applications that guide your operators through complex tasks using interactive work instructions, integrated images, and video. By connecting your tools, machines, and sensors directly to the platform, you eliminate manual data entry and gain a real-time view of your production performance.

The platform solves the problem of rigid, expensive legacy systems by giving you a flexible environment to iterate on your processes. You can track key performance indicators like cycle times and defect rates instantly, allowing you to identify bottlenecks before they impact your bottom line. Whether you are managing a single cell or multiple global facilities, you can scale your digital transformation at your own pace.

Vimachem MES

Vimachem MES helps you transition from paper-based manufacturing to a fully digital shop floor. You can manage your entire production lifecycle, from weighing and dispensing to packaging, while maintaining strict adherence to GxP and FDA 21 CFR Part 11 regulations. The platform eliminates manual data entry errors by capturing real-time information directly from your equipment and operators.

You can streamline your quality control with automated electronic batch records (eBR) and real-time alerts for process deviations. This modular approach allows you to implement specific features like warehouse management or equipment tracking as your needs grow. It is specifically built for the life sciences industry, ensuring you meet complex compliance requirements without slowing down your manufacturing throughput.

Vimachem MES Features

  • Electronic Batch Records. Replace paper documentation with digital batch records to ensure data integrity and speed up your release cycles.
  • Weighing and Dispensing. Guide your operators through precise material handling with integrated scale communication to prevent costly formulation errors.
  • Equipment Management. Track the status, usage, and calibration schedules of your machinery to ensure every asset is production-ready.
  • Real-time Monitoring. View live production data on interactive dashboards so you can identify bottlenecks and address deviations immediately.
  • Warehouse Integration. Manage your raw materials and finished goods with full traceability from the moment they enter your facility.
  • Compliance Workflows. Enforce standard operating procedures with digital signatures and audit trails that satisfy strict regulatory requirements.
